Background Intelligent Transfer Service (BITS) op Windows 10

Achtergrond intelligente overdrachtsservice ( Bits ) is een systeemcomponent in het Microsoft Windows-besturingssysteem dat asynchrone, geprioriteerde en beperkte overdracht van bestanden tussen machines mogelijk maakt met behulp van inactieve netwerkbandbreedte. Het speelt ook een rol bij het downloaden van bestanden van een peer. Dit BITS-service is essentieel voor een goede werking van Windows Updates. Als de service is uitgeschakeld, zijn alle toepassingen die afhankelijk zijn van BITS, zoals Windows Update of MSN Explorer, zal niet automatisch programma's en andere informatie kunnen downloaden.

Achtergrond Intelligent Transfer Service BITS voor het eerst geïntroduceerd op Windows 2000, waarmee bestanden tussen server en client kunnen worden overgedragen. Recente versies van Microsoft Update, Windows Update, Microsoft Systems Management Server en Windows Server Update Services gebruiken Background Intelligent Transfer Service om de applicatie-updates aan clients te leveren.



Inhoud posten: -

Hoe BITS-service werkt

Er zijn drie soorten taken overzetten uitgevoerd door Background Intelligent Transfer Service (BITS). Een downloadtaak downloadt bestanden naar de client, een uploadtaak uploadt een bestand naar de server, en een upload-antwoordtaak uploadt een bestand naar de server en ontvangt een antwoordbestand van de servertoepassing.

  • Breng bestanden asynchroon over op de voorgrond of achtergrond.
  • Behoud het reactievermogen van andere netwerktoepassingen.
  • Hervat automatisch bestandsoverdrachten nadat het netwerk is verbroken en de computer opnieuw is opgestart.

Versiegeschiedenis van Background Intelligent Transfer Service (BITS)

Microsoft introduceerde voor het eerst Background Intelligent Transfer Service op Windows 2000



Volgende Microsoft Upgraded BITS-versie 1.0 in Windows XP in 2001.

Dan Versie 1.2.28 arriveerde medio 2002 om de service Automatische updates toe te voegen aan Windows 2000.

Met Windows Server 2003 Microsoft-updates BITS-versie 1.5 eind 2003 en bracht opdrachtregelondersteuning, meer uploadfuncties en beveiligingsverbeteringen.



BITS-versie 2.0 , uitgebracht medio 2004 als een update voor meerdere OS-implementaties, meer downloadfuncties, bandbreedtebeperking en ondersteuning voor Server Message Block (SMB) toegevoegd.

Medio 2007 uitgebracht, BITS-versie 2.5 ondersteuning toegevoegd voor IPv6 en aangepaste HTTP-headers, en betere HTTP-beveiliging.

Met Windows Vista en Windows Server 2008, inclusief Microsoft BITS-versie 3.0 met peer-caching, meldingen, tijdelijke bestandstoegang, verwerking van HTTP-omleidingen, aanvullende besturingselementen voor groepsbeleid en logboekregistratie van gebeurtenissen.



Medio 2009 heeft Microsoft BITS-versie 4.0 opgenomen in Windows 7 en Windows Server 2008 R2, op tokens gebaseerde beveiliging, standalone bestandsserverfuncties, verfijnde bandbreedtebeperking en herziene peer-caching.

BITS 5.0, opgenomen in Windows 10 medio 2016, verbeterde verbeteringen aan kopieeropdrachten op de achtergrond en ondersteuning voor oudere kopieeropdrachten op de achtergrond, en de mogelijkheid om BITS te gebruiken via API's en PowerShell cmd-lets.



Met Windows 10-makerupdate Versie 1703 Microsoft upgrade BITS versie 10.1 met verfijnde download- en meldingsfuncties.

De versie van BITS op een computer bepalen

Om de versie van BITS op de clientcomputer te bepalen, controleert u de versie van QMgr.dll. Om het versienummer van de DLL te vinden:



  • Zoek QMgr.dll in% windir% System32.
  • Klik met de rechtermuisknop op QMgr.dll en klik op Eigendommen .
  • Klik op de Versie tabblad.
  • Noteer het versienummer.

U kunt ook de volgende PowerShell-code gebruiken om de versie van de .dll op uw systeem te bepalen:

get-item 'C: Windows System32 qmgr.dll' | Select-Object -ExpandProperty VersionInfo



Als de DLL ook bestaat in% windir% System32 Bits, herhaalt u de vorige stappen. BITS gebruikt de DLL met het hogere versienummer.

Hoe BITS-service starten / opnieuw starten?

Op een Windows-computer, Achtergrond intelligente overdrachtsservice is ingesteld om automatisch te starten bij het opstarten. Maar om een ​​of andere reden, als de service niet is gestart, kunt u verschillende problemen tegenkomen bij het controleren en installeren van Windows-updates. Daarom moet u de BITS-service handmatig controleren en starten.

Druk hiervoor op Windows + R sleutel type services.msc en druk op de enter-toets om Windows-services te openen. Scroll nu naar beneden en zoek Achtergrond intelligente overdrachtsservice. Als deze service actief is, klikt u er gewoon met de rechtermuisknop op en selecteert u Opnieuw opstarten. Hiermee wordt de BITS-service opnieuw gestart en opgelost als de service om welke reden dan ook vastloopt.

Of als de Service niet is gestart, dubbelklik er dan gewoon op. Verander in een nieuwe pop-up onder het algemene tabblad het opstarttype Automatisch en start de service naast de servicestatus zoals hieronder weergegeven.

Start de BITS-service en start deze opnieuw
Start de BITS-service en start deze opnieuw

Hoe BITS-service te stoppen?

Als om een ​​of andere reden BITS-service loopt vast, reageert niet u kunt worden geconfronteerd Hoog gebruik van systeembronnen probleem. Zoals 100% CPU-gebruik , Hoog schijf- of geheugengebruik enz. En terwijl we deze problemen oplossen, moeten we de BIT-service stoppen om het probleem op te lossen. Ook suggereren de meeste gebruikers op Microsoft Forum, Reddit BITS-service uitschakelen om het probleem met het hoge CPU-gebruik op te lossen.

BITS-service uitschakelen Open opnieuw Windows-services door op windows + R te drukken, typ services.msc en druk op de enter-toets. Dubbelklik op BITS-service, wijzig het opstarttype om de service uit te schakelen en stop te zetten als deze actief is

Bits-service uitschakelen
Bits-service uitschakelen

Start / stop BITS met de opdrachtprompt

U kunt ook de Windows-opdrachtprompt gebruiken om de BITS-service te starten / stoppen. Open hiervoor de opdrachtprompt als beheerder. Gebruik dan eerst het commando sc bits query om te controleren De service is actief of niet. Als alles in orde is, ziet u ' STAAT: 2 RUNNING ”In de uitgangen. Je kan vinden ' SATE: 1 STOP_PENDING '.

Controleer de BITS-service starten en stoppen
Controleer de BITS-service starten en stoppen

Dan kun je command gebruiken net start bits om de BITs-service te starten. En u kunt het commando gebruiken net stop bits om de service te stoppen.

Ik hoop dat dit bericht je helpt meer te weten over Achtergrond intelligente overdrachtsservice . Hoe BITS-service werkt op de Windows-computer, verschillende versie van BITs-service met functie-updates. En hoe u Background Intelligent Transfer Service start, herstart of stopt met behulp van de opdrachtprompt enz. Lees ook Oplossing We kunnen uw camerafout 0xA00F4244 niet vinden in Windows 10.

Top